#9d0108 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d0108 is composed of 61.6% red, 0.4%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.4%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 357.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 31%. #9d0108 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0210 with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

● #9d0108 color description : Dark red.
#9d0108 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9d0108 has RGB values of R:157, G:1,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.95,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10289416.

Shades and Tints of #9d0108
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#ffeded is the lightest one.

Tones of #9d0108
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#544a4a is the less saturated color, while #9d0108 is the most saturated one.
